Front crankshaft oil seal (Range Rover 3)

Contents: Removal ⇩ Installation ⇩
Before disconnecting the battery, make sure that all requirements and conditions contained in the section on disconnecting the battery are met.

GENERAL INFORMATION, Precautions when working with electrical equipment.

Removal


1. Place the vehicle on a lift.

2. Disconnect the negative battery terminal.

3. Remove the crankshaft pulley.

V8 Engine, REPAIR WORK, Crankshaft Pulley.

4. Secure the LRT-12-229 stopper to the crankshaft hub.


4. Secure the LRT-12-229 stopper to the crankshaft hub.

5. Press the LRT-12-229 stopper against the subframe and unscrew the central bolt.


5. Press the LRT-12-229 stopper against the subframe and unscrew the central bolt.

6. Remove the LRT-12-229 stopper from the crankshaft hub.

7. Remove the crankshaft hub.



8. Install the LRT-12-230/1 puller and the LRT-12-230/2 stop and remove the front oil seal.


8. Install the LRT-12-230/1 puller and the LRT-12-230/2 stop and remove the front oil seal.

9. Discard the seal.

Installation


1. Wipe the oil seal seat.

2. Insert the oil seal into the front cover using the LRT-12-231 drift.


2. Insert the oil seal into the front cover using the LRT-12-231 drift.

NOTE: The front oil seal must be installed flush with the front cover.


3. Remove the LRT-12-231 mandrel.

4. Wipe the crankshaft pulley hub and mounting surfaces, install the hub on the crankshaft.

5. Screw a new central bolt into the crankshaft, fix the crankshaft with the LRT-12-229 stopper, pre-tighten the central bolt to a torque of 100 N·m. Using a bevel torque wrench, tighten the bolt in the sequence shown below.
  • Stage 1: 60°.
  • Stage 2: 60°.
  • Stage 3: 30°.

6. Remove the LRT-12-229 stopper from the crankshaft hub.



7. Install the crankshaft pulley.

V8 Engine, REPAIR WORK, Crankshaft Pulley.


8. Connect the negative battery terminal.
